Ethereum Price Prediction: ETH Hits 8-Month High, $10K Calls Grow

Key Insights:

  • Ethereum Price Prediction strengthened as ETH reached an eight-month high.
  • Whale activity rose as Ethereum surpassed $2,630 on Friday.
  • Traders split between $2,670 rejection and longer-term $10,000 calls.

Ethereum price advanced above $2,630 on Sept. 18 and reached its highest level since January. This price move revived Ethereum price prediction calls that targeted higher levels as market activity strengthened.

The ETH price rise mattered because the leading altcoin entered the upper end of its recent trading range. Higher spot volume, whale transfers, and locked staking supply gave traders more data. However, none of those indicators alone confirmed continued upside.

The rally also reopened a sharp debate over ETH’s next directional move. Some traders targeted $10,000, while others identified $2,670 as a possible rejection zone.

Ethereum Price Prediction Strengthens After 8-Month High

CoinMarketCap data showed Ethereum trading near $2,619, up about 7.6% over 24 hours. ETH traded between roughly $2,435 and $2,644, while daily volume reached $21.63 billion.

The move followed several sessions of relatively contained trading. CoinMarketCap recorded ETH near $2,449 on Sept. 17, 2026, and around $2,418 one day earlier.

Santiment said Ethereum moved above $2,630 on Friday, marking its highest market value since January. The analytics firm also reported a rise in whale transactions as the Ethereum Price advanced.

The Santiment data showed Ethereum reached a record 207.17 million non-empty wallets. That increase showed broader address participation alongside the latest price recovery.

However, rising whale transaction counts do not confirm accumulation. The metric measures large transfers rather than the direction of buying or selling.

Ethereum Price Faces $2,670 Test

Short-term market structure placed attention immediately above the latest intraday high. CoinMarketCap recorded a 24-hour peak near $2,644, placing $2,670 nearby. Crypto trader Discover described $2,670 as a potential bull-trap area. The trader projected a subsequent decline toward $1,800 and later $1,500.

Those levels represented one trader’s scenario rather than confirmed market targets. ETH had not reached either downside level when the forecast circulated.

A competing thesis came from Mister Crypto, who said ETH/BTC had broken a nine-year downtrend. The analyst argued that ETH could eventually reach $10,000. The trader also cited approximately 1.9 million daily Ethereum transactions.

That transaction estimate aligned closely with current DefiLlama data. The platform recorded roughly 1.96 million Ethereum transactions over 24 hours. Neither forecast established a probable outcome. Current evidence instead showed the ETH crypto market approaching resistance after a rapid daily advance.

Ethereum Crypto Gets On-Chain Support

Santiment said whale transactions increased while Ethereum’s holder base expanded. The combination showed a rise in large-value activity during the latest rally.

Network usage also remained elevated. DefiLlama recorded roughly 599,000 active addresses alongside the elevated daily transaction count.

DefiLlama reported Ethereum’s decentralized finance total value locked (TVL) around $52.28 billion. It also recorded about $1.53 billion in decentralized exchange volume over 24 hours.

Staking represented another large pool of committed ETH. Ethereum.org showed roughly 43.27 million ETH staked, representing about 35% of the supply.

Ethereum documentation states that validators deposit ETH to participate in proof-of-stake consensus. Pooled services let smaller holders participate without operating individual validators.

These figures supported continued network use but did not directly predict price direction. Total value locked can also rise when deposited assets appreciate.

Ethereum Price Prediction Hinges on Resistance Break

The next market test centered on the zone between the recent high and $2,670. A sustained move above it would clear resistance cited by bearish traders.

Failure there would refocus attention on the previous $2,435-$2,450 trading range. CoinMarketCap data showed ETH occupied that range before Friday’s surge.

The wider Ethereum Price outlook also depended on whale behavior after the breakout. Rising transaction counts alone cannot distinguish accumulation from distribution.

Ethereum’s underlying network metrics remained firm during the move. Yet $10,000 remained roughly 279% above an ETH price near $2,640.

For now, $2,670 provides the next observable market level. Price behavior there could clarify whether ETH extends its breakout or returns toward its prior range.
